La porte Saint-Jean de Joigny est un édifice situé dans la ville de Joigny, dans l'Yonne en région Bourgogne-Franche-Comté.

Joigny is a commune in the Yonne département in Bourgogne-Franche-Comté in north-central France.
It is located on the banks of the river Yonne.

Histoire
Le siècle de la campagne de construction est le XIIIe siècle. La porte Saint-Jean et les remparts attenants sont classés au titre des monuments historiques par arrêté du 5 décembre 1941.
